hzOduRadio1TransmitPowerDbm

HORIZON-ODU-MIB · .1.3.6.1.4.1.7262.2.2.5.1.3.2

Object

scalar mandatory r/w Integer32
This defines the transmit level of the radio.
If ATPC is enabled, you can't change the transmit power.
          
The power you see is divided by 10. e.g. A display
of 133 is actually 13.3 dBm.
          
If the radio is operational and not muted, it is the 
current transmitting power.
          
If the radio is operational and muted, it is the 
programmed transmitting power, and will transmit at 
this level when the radio is un-muted.
          						 
If the radio is not operational it is the programmed 
transmitting power, and will transmit at this level 
when the radio is operational and not muted.
           
If the radio does not have transmit calibration tables 
programmed into its EEPROM, this transmit power level 
cannot be used as it is not possible to accurately 
calculate the actual transmit level. In this case this 
object will return -99.
